Title of article :
Comparison of Kayzero for Windows and k0-IAEA software packages for k0 standardization in neutron activation analysis

Abstract :
For many years the well-established Kayzero for Windows software for neutron activation analysis (NAA) using k0 standardization was the only commercial program available. Recently, the freeware k0-IAEA software has been launched by the International Atomic Energy Agency (IAEA). The software is based on an adapted Høgdahl convention in which the cadmium cut-off energy from the k0-formulas is removed. The holistic approach of γ-ray spectra evaluation is used which minimizes the userʹs interaction with the software.
l certified reference materials were analyzed with the k0-IAEA and Kayzero for Windows software using the same gamma-ray spectra obtained from several irradiation and counting modes. The results obtained were compared and evaluated in terms of precision, accuracy and detection limits. The work-flow procedures performed by the two software packages and the results obtained are discussed.
